@@jordanbrock8199 they're not locking their knees and remaining completely still. The human body is not designed to stand without moving. Standing requires the heart to pump the blood much harder, and that requires some level of physical exertion to increase heart rate. Something as little as shaking your leg or moving your hands can often be more than enough, but standing completely still without any kind of body readjustments can be extremely dangerous. This is well known in the military, which is why for instance soldiers on guard duty regularly march back and forth a few feet every couple of minutes. This is intentional to give the body the ability to increase the blood flow and decrease the risk of fainting. Standing completely still at attention for instance is usually the worst situation you can be in when it comes to this risk. When it comes to super market store workers, yes they are standing, but I think for obvious reasons you can understand that they are not standing completely still. It is your natural instinct to move, and you're not gonna do it without intentionally making an effort not yo move.

That was a vasovagal attack, when blood pressure drop and not enough of it can reach the brain. Treatment is to bring head lower, so that gravity helps blood reaching brain. Keeping head and person upright risks permanent brain damage. So, when someone faints, lay them flat on the ground, with no pillow, and lift the legs up so that enough blood finds it easier to reach brain rather than legs.
